Laser cut keys Laser-cut car keys provide an innovative and secure alternative to traditional keys. They have an unchanging depth in their center which ensures that the key will fit into the cylinder of your ignition regardless of how it turns. They also come with built-in transponders. Laser cut car keys come with an aesthetically distinctive look compared to regular keys. They are also lighter and less bulky than regular keys, adding security. Additionally, they feature transponder chips inside them, making them more difficult to duplicate. It is essential that the person cutting them has previous experience programming and cutting them. While regular keys are easy to cut with the simplest home key machine, laser keys require a precise laser cutting machine. Laser keys are therefore more expensive than regular keys. A millimeter difference in height or depth could render a regular one useless, so the process of cutting the laser key requires a high-precision computerized laser cutting machine.
